Master
filmmaker Krzysztof Zanussi returns behind the
camera with Revisited, a pastiche of sorts that
connects four of his earlier works filmed at different
points throughout his career. A fake documentary
filmed within the world of Zanussi's characters,
it looks at where they have all gone since the
endings of their own movies. Stefan (from A Heart
in the Palm) interviews other past Zanussi characters
(all played by their original actors), trying
to make sense of his own story. This pseudo-sequel
acts as a reflection on previous works, while
managing to also create a new dialogue between
Zanussi and his viewers. Incorporating actual
footage from the films, this piece convinces us
that his characters have lived alongside us all
these years, and continues the philosophically
poignant discussions that were then introduced.
A unique and interesting examination of his own
work, the director has seemingly set his characters
free and has now allowed us to view them in the
wild. Truly a picture that plays with the form
of cinema and asks what it means to bring a character
to life on film.
